Joe and Lindsey Anderson serve in Dallas, Texas, an area with many under-resourced urban communities. This area is in desperate need of long-term, community-based missionaries. To address this need, the Andersons began serving children, teens, and adults through a number of ministries.
Local Reach
The Andersons established a “gospel eco-system” by partnering with the community and directing Kids for Christ, Teens for Christ, and Homemakers for Christ ministries in inner city Dallas. Through these ministries, they guide young people through various life stages. These ministries also train leaders to carry on the work in communities throughout the Dallas area. Site leaders take a relational approach to ministry, which allows them to walk through times of crisis with young people growing through the team’s ministries. Many of these leaders are products of the Andersons' ministries.
Joe and Lindsey, InFaith area coordinators for Texas, oversee field staff engaged in refugee ministry; police, military, and hospital chaplaincies; and church, camp, and inner city ministry. They have been serving as InFaith field staff since 2005.

Joe and Lindsey grew up in the ministries they are now leading with InFaith. They enjoy the long-term committed relationships of residents and ministry partners living in their InFaith ministry communities. Roseland Homes, a community led by the Andersons, has been an InFaith ministry site for over 30 years and continues to be a place of genuine, transformational, exciting, challenging, and growing ministry.
